Reviews by The Hwahae Testers undergo the same strict verification process as regular reviews, and if they don't meet our standards, revisions will be requested.ProsFor my sensitive skin with pigmentation/acne scars, this is an essential item for me when applying makeup as it provides great coverage without irritating my skin. The positives: 1. Color The shade is not too bright or too dark, and it matches my skin tone well. It covers blemishes and imperfections without looking patchy. 2. Texture I believe concealers need a certain level of creaminess, and this product has the right amount - it's not heavy but provides adequate coverage. 3. Adherence I consider this the most important factor, and this product is among the top in terms of adherence for Korean base makeup. It applies seamlessly without creasing or sliding off. 4. No Irritation As someone with sensitive skin, any product that clogs my pores can trigger breakouts, but I've never experienced that with this concealer. 5. Longevity I can wear this from morning until late evening without needing to touch up, and it doesn't flake off. Among products with this level of coverage and performance, I haven't found any other non-irritating options, which is why I've been repurchasing this for the past 5 years. I strongly recommend this to anyone with acne-prone skin who needs reliable coverage.
ConsThere wasn't really any part that bothered me, but if I had to pick one, it would be the separation phenomenon. After opening the product and using it for a while, the oil layer and the pigment layer sometimes separate, and the oil leaks out. But it's not something that concerns me that much.
TipI don't use foundation, so I'm using this product as a base instead. Since I don't have a tinted sunscreen/tone-up cream that matches my skin, I make my own by mixing 90% mineral sunscreen and about 10% concealer, then gently patting it on with my hands to get a natural tone-up effect. After applying it all over, I use concealer to cover any acne scars or blemishes, which allows me to achieve a clear and lightweight skin expression. I used to apply sunscreen and then lightly apply concealer, but doing that would make my makeup look patchy and uneven by the evening. However, by mixing and applying it thinly, I'm able to maintain a smooth, flawless skin expression late into the evening.
